**Action Item 7: Harden the Marrowgate partner SFTP drop**

Owner: integrations team, due end of sprint. The incident occurred because a partner upload stalled mid-transfer and our importer processed the partial file. Going forward, partners must upload to a staging directory and the importer must only act on files after an atomic rename plus checksum match. The release manager should verify the new gate is enabled before each partner onboarding. Implementation details and the verification checklist are on the internal page below.

dashboard of tahop-fahof = https://harbor.tolvaqnet.example/secrets/merge_requests/board/issue/merge_requests/pipeline/secrets/ecb30ed86a55c001a77f6cb9

Runbook §7 — Cold-start mitigation for Orvane handlers. Before cutover, invoke each handler twice through the canary route; the first call initializes the runtime and the second confirms steady-state latency under 400 ms. Do not proceed if any handler exceeds budget on the second call. When all handlers pass, sign the release manifest with the key below.

signing key of bagap-yawep = bky13_TbfT6ZMUoGJo2

**Mgmt Meeting Minutes — Retiring the Brightline Range**

Quick recap for sales leads at Fenholt Supplies: we agreed to retire the Brightline fixture range by year-end. Remaining stock moves to clearance pricing next month, and accounts on standing orders get migrated to the Lumetta range. Trade-in incentives were approved in principle. The confidential note on next steps sits just below.

board note of bajof-bajeg: The pricing group signed off on a budget of $13.4 million for Project Sildor. The renewal with Lamixek Holdings closes at $48.9 million a year, 49 percent above the last contract.